Though it’s hard to meet face to face these days, career fairs remain an important way to connect, albeit virtually.
Andrew Lehrer served as the engineering career representative at the Companies That Care Virtual Career Fair this week, which was attended by almost 100 students, professionals and organizers. Lehrer helped students explore career options and deepened their understanding of the realities, challenges and rewards associated with various engineering careers via Zoom.
